This wasn't hugely high on my list of "movies to see," but within about ten minutes of putting it on I realized it was going to be a movie I really, really enjoyed. It's difficult to find a word that accurately describes the feel of this movie, but I think the closest is "fanciful." Even when looking at the difficulties in this man's life - his rocky marriage, his disillusionment, his unusual family relationships - there's still something magical and free that jumped out at me every time he took the stage. The sequence early on in the movie where Bobby decides to go to New York to try and make it big is one of the loveliest moments I've seen in a movie in a long time. Something about it just struck home for me... I definitely got chills.

I must also say Kevin Spacey was absolutely superb in this role. Sometimes when actors take on roles as singers they don't come across as at all natural. That was not the case here.

This is definitely an artist's movie, or a movie for people who like biographies.
